Output ecf7da68c89353ed1242352fb606b67460163e281fd887a5557c437943dae4ed:1

value
2580560
script pubkey
OP_0 OP_PUSHBYTES_20 9d4ba6752602e97a1cfa8b362c08a197df26bc65
address
ltc1qn496vafxqt5h58863vmzcz9pjl0jd0r93pp676
transaction
ecf7da68c89353ed1242352fb606b67460163e281fd887a5557c437943dae4ed
spent
true